thermodynamic tell us …
which states of the system are favored or disfavored
kinetics tell us …
how fast we move from one disfavored state to another favored state
What is a system?
it is what we want to study
What is an environment?
it is everything around our system
What can be exchanged between out system and the environment?
volume, energy, and mass
What are three ways to describe systems?
isolated, open, closed
What is an isolated system?
where no mass or energy can exchange
What is an open system?
where mass and energy can exchange
What is a closed system?
where mass cannot exchange and where energy can exchange
What are 3 ways to describe the walls of a system?
adiabatic, permeable, impermeable
What does adiabatic mean?
the walls DON’T allow energy transfer
What does permeable mean?
the walls allow mass to exchange
What does impermeable mean?
that the walls DON’T allow mass to exchange
What does semipermeable mean?
the walls allow for limited mass to exchange
What does isobaric condition mean?
it has the same pressure (constant)
What does isothermal mean?
it has the same temperature (constant)

What are intensive variables?
do not depend on system size
Are these intensive or extensive variables?
temperature & pressure
What are extensive variables?
depend on the size of the system
Are these intensive or extensive variables?
volume, number of moles, total energy
What is microstate?
specifies number, position, and momentum of all particles in a system
What is macrostate?
an overall description of a system using macroscopic variables
(i.e. P, V, N, T)
What does Gibb’s phase rule tell us?
it tells us how many independent intensive variables we are free to use when defining the macrostate at equilibrium
What is an equation of state?
a mathematical relationship connecting macrostate variables
